During the height of the COVID-19 pandemic, Niantic implemented temporary changes to Pokémon GO to promote safety and social distancing. These included shrinking the range within which players could interact with PokéStops and gyms—allowing people to stay closer to shelters, avoid crossing roads, and reduce the risk of injury or exposure.

Many community members praised these adjustments, especially those with disabilities or health concerns. The expanded interaction radius meant that players with mobility challenges could participate more easily, interacting with points of interest from safer, more accessible locations. Parents with young children could manage gameplay more comfortably, and individuals with sensory or physical limitations found the game more inclusive.
